About Company
The client launched a next-generation, SaaS-based application – a Netflix-style video library that aims provides a secure, scalable, cloud-based, remotely managed, multi-tenanted platform to monetize and stream videos, webinars, and events year-round through a branded video channel.
The application enables the delivery of highly mobile content, empowering organizations to be the go-to location for professional education and content. With white-label branding, the client can launch their own video channel, sell videos, channels, and webinars, launch subscriptions with ease, run live streams and virtual events, engage and interact with online viewers, and deliver courses and continuing education, creating an engaged and connected online community
The Challenge
Numosaic’s client faced multifaceted challenges that impeded the seamless operation of their leading Video Monetization SaaS Platform. These challenges included:
1. Scalability Issues: The platform experienced difficulties in accommodating the rapidly growing demand from its global user base. As user engagement and content consumption surged, the existing infrastructure struggled to scale effectively to meet the increasing workload demands.
2. Manual Deployment Processes: The client relied on labor-intensive, manual deployment processes for application and database updates. This manual approach not only consumed valuable time and resources but also introduced the potential for human error, leading to deployment inconsistencies and delays.
3. Security Vulnerabilities: The platform’s architecture was susceptible to security vulnerabilities, posing risks to data integrity and user privacy. Without robust security measures in place, the client faced the looming threat of cyberattacks, data breaches, and unauthorized access to sensitive information.
4. Deployment Automation Concerns: There were apprehensions regarding the automation of deployment processes. While automation promised increased efficiency and reliability, the client was cautious about implementing automated deployment solutions without adequate safeguards and quality control measures in place.